feat(local-issuer): RFC 5280 §4.2.1.13 CRLDistributionPoints auto-injection (Phase 6)
Production hardening II Phase 6 — close the operator-must-manually- configure-CDP gap that the EST hardening prompt's deferral list flagged. When the local issuer has CRLDistributionPointURLs configured, every issued cert carries the id-ce-cRLDistributionPoints extension pointing at the configured URLs. Relying parties (browsers, OpenSSL, cert-manager) read the CDP and fetch the CRL automatically; without this extension, operators have to ship the CRL endpoint URL out-of- band. NEW Config field internal/connector/issuer/local/local.go:: Config.CRLDistributionPointURLs []string. Empty (default) preserves pre-Phase-6 behavior — no CDP extension. Refusing to silently inject an empty CDP is frozen decision 0.9 from the production hardening II prompt: a cert with an empty CDP extension fails relying-party validation worse than a cert with no CDP at all. Issuer wire: generateCertificate appends the configured URLs to template.CRLDistributionPoints. crypto/x509 handles the ASN.1 encoding (RFC 5280 §4.2.1.13) — no manual marshaling needed. Operator config (cmd/server/main.go wire-up to follow when the operator opts in via per-issuer config-blob fields; the local issuer's existing dynamic-config-via-GUI path picks up the new field via the standard JSON unmarshal). Typical value: ["https://certctl.example.com:8443/.well-known/pki/crl/iss-local"] Pre-commit verification: go build ./... clean; go test -short -count=1 green for connector/issuer/local/.
